After nearly a century of recovery from overhunting, sea otter populations are in abrupt decline over large areas of western Alaska. The spatial distribution of kelp (Laminaria hyperborea) and sea urchins (Strongylocentrotus droebachiensis) in the NE Atlantic are highly related to physical factors and to temporal changes in temperature. As … Elevated sea urchin density and the consequent deforestation of kelp beds in the nearshore community demonstrate that the otter's keystone role has been reduced or eliminated. The species of kelp that make up California's kelp beds, Macrocystis pyrifera (Giant Kelp), can grow up to 40-65m high and at a speed of 60cm (2ft) a day! When orcas started eating sea otters in the kelp forest ecosystem, the sea otter population decreased, the sea urchin population increased, and the kelp population decreased (Answer choice B).
